PRODUCTS DETAILS

As the material of exothermic welding mold, graphite has the following characteristics: 1) High temperature resistance: The melting point of graphite is 3850±50℃, and the boiling point is 4250℃. Even if burned by ultra-high temperature arc, the weight loss is very small, and the thermal expansion coefficient is also very small. The strength of graphite increases with increasing temperature. At 2000°C, the strength of graphite doubles. The temperature of the chemical reaction that ignites the exothermic flux during the exothermic welding construction is very high, so the material used in the exothermic welding mold needs to be resistant to high temperatures. 2) Electrical and thermal conductivity: The electrical conductivity of graphite is one hundred times higher than that of general non-metallic minerals. The thermal conductivity exceeds that of metal materials such as steel, iron, and lead. Thermal conductivity decreases with increasing temperature, even at extremely high temperatures, graphite becomes an insulator. Graphite can conduct electricity because each carbon atom in graphite forms only 3 covalent bonds with other carbon atoms, and each carbon atom still retains 1 free electron to transfer charge. In the exothermic welding construction, it is often necessary to weld a lot of points, and the amount of construction is not small. The thermal conductivity of graphite can meet this point, which can withstand high temperatures and can quickly cool down. 3) Lubricity determines the thoroughness of separation: The graphite block of the exothermic welding mold has a small friction coefficient and good lubricity. After the welding is completed, the separation from the welding material is very thorough. 4) Chemical stability determines use and storage life: the finished exothermic welding mold has good chemical stability at room temperature, and is resistant to acid, alkali and organic solvent corrosion. 5) Durability of exothermic welding mold: Graphite has good toughness and can be crushed into very thin flake. Exothermic welding sometimes requires exothermic welding molds of various joint forms. Easy-processing graphite can be machined into exothermic welding molds of different models, specifications, and connection forms. Based on the above necessary characteristics of exothermic welding molds, we choose high-purity graphite to process the molds.Grade: NX82 Grain size(≤): 0.8mm Bulk Density(≥): 1.72g/cm3 Ash (≤): 0.3% Specific Resistance ≤8.5μΩM Compressive Strength ≥35MPa Flexural Strength ≥13.5MPa Coefficient of Thermal Expansion ≤2.2×10-6/℃The ash content can be purified to 30ppm according to the requirement. / The above index data is the standard value, not the guaranteed value.Grade: NX603 Grain Size(≤): 25μm Bulk Density(≥): 1.80g/cm3 Compressive Strength(≥): 60MPa Flexural Strength(≥): 30MPa Porosity(≤): 17% Specific Resistance(≤): 12μΩm Ash Content(≤): 600ppm Shore Hardness: 50 Coefficient of Thermal Expansion(≤): 5×10-6/℃
